Choosing the right tire inflator 12V involves balancing multiple factors. Understanding your specific needs—whether for occasional emergency use or frequent roadside inflation—can help narrow down options. Beyond basic features, consider how the device’s power source, inflation speed, and durability impact everyday use. Proper selection ensures not only convenience but also safety and longevity, especially if you encounter challenging inflation tasks or rough conditions.Power and Compatibility
Most 12V inflators connect directly to your vehicle’s cigarette lighter or power outlet, but some offer dual power sources including batteries or AC adapters. A model with a reliable power connection ensures consistent performance without draining your car battery excessively. For frequent use or larger tires, look for units with higher wattage and longer power cords, which can handle bigger demands without overheating or shutting down prematurely. Compatibility with different vehicle types is also key, especially if you own more than one vehicle or use the inflator for bikes or sports equipment.
Inflation Speed and PSI Capacity
Speed matters when you’re in a pinch, so compare inflation times across models. High PSI capacity—generally 150 PSI or more—is important for larger tires or truck wheels. However, faster inflation often means higher wattage and potentially more noise. For casual drivers, a model with moderate PSI and decent speed may be sufficient, while professionals or RV owners should prioritize high PSI ratings and rapid inflation capabilities to save time and effort.
Ease of Use and Features
Look for features that simplify operation such as digital pressure gauges, auto shutoff, and LED lights. These features prevent over-inflation, improve safety, and make it easier to see in low-light conditions. A user-friendly interface with clearly labeled buttons and a straightforward setup can make a significant difference, especially if you’re new to portable inflators. However, more features often add complexity and cost, so consider what you truly need for your typical inflation tasks.
Build Quality and Portability
Durability is vital, especially if you plan to keep the inflator in your trunk or garage long-term. Metal components and high-quality plastics tend to last longer and resist damage from rough handling. Portability is also a key factor—compact, lightweight models are easier to store and carry, but they might sacrifice some power or speed. Larger, more robust units often include additional accessories and higher PSI ratings, making them better suited for frequent or demanding use.
Price and Value
While premium models offer more features and faster performance, they also come with higher price tags. For occasional roadside emergencies, a budget-friendly inflator might suffice, but frequent users should consider investing in a more durable, faster model. Multi-purpose units that can inflate other items like balls or bike tires add extra value, especially if versatility matters. Always weigh the initial cost against long-term reliability and the potential need for replacements or repairs.
Frequently Asked Questions
How do I know if a 12V tire inflator is powerful enough for my tires?
Check the PSI rating of the inflator—most standard car tires require around 30-35 PSI, but larger tires or trucks need higher PSI ratings, often 150 PSI or more. An inflator with a higher PSI capacity and faster inflation speed will handle larger tires more efficiently. Additionally, consider the inflator’s wattage and whether it can sustain continuous operation without overheating. For regular use on larger tires or RVs, investing in a higher-capacity model ensures you won’t be left waiting or underpowered.
Are cordless 12V tire inflators as reliable as corded models?
Cordless inflators offer unmatched convenience and portability, especially for emergency use or outdoor activities. However, they typically have limited battery life and may take longer to inflate larger tires compared to corded models connected directly to your vehicle’s power outlet. For occasional, quick fixes, cordless models work well, but for frequent or high-demand tasks, a corded inflator with a higher power output usually delivers more consistent and faster performance. Always check the battery capacity and recharge time when considering cordless options.
Should I prioritize inflators with auto shutoff or manual control?
Auto shutoff features provide a major safety and convenience advantage, preventing over-inflation and allowing you to set the desired pressure and walk away. This is especially useful if you’re inflating multiple tires or working in low-light conditions. Manual control may save some initial cost but requires constant monitoring, increasing the risk of over-inflation or injury. For most users, models with auto shutoff offer better peace of mind and consistent results, making them worth the additional investment.
Is a higher PSI rating always better?
Not necessarily. While a higher PSI rating allows you to inflate larger tires or sports equipment, most passenger vehicle tires require only around 30-35 PSI. A very high PSI rating can be advantageous for trucks or specialized equipment but is unnecessary for standard cars. Overly high PSI capacity may also mean higher cost, increased noise, and heavier weight. Focus on matching the inflator’s PSI capabilities with your typical needs rather than simply opting for the highest rating available.
What features should I look for if I’m a beginner?
Beginners should prioritize simplicity and safety features. An inflator with a clear digital display, auto shutoff, and an easy-to-operate interface reduces the risk of mistakes. Compact size and lightweight design make it easier to handle and store. Additionally, a built-in LED light can be a real advantage for nighttime or low-light situations. Avoid overly complex models with many buttons or settings—simplicity often leads to a better user experience for those new to portable inflators.
